Lease Renegotiation — Harwick Quay Facility (Managers Only). This page records the current state of negotiations with the landlord, Penrose Estates, on the Harwick Quay lease expiring next year. Headline terms under discussion: a seven-year extension, a rent-free period of six months, and removal of the upward-only review clause. Counsel advises our break option strengthens our position, though relocation costs to the Dalton Park alternative remain material. The board should note the fallback position agreed by the committee, summarised below.

board note of baguf-fafog: Kasixox Foods plans to lower the Drueth list price by 48 percent in March.

## Runbook: Retrying failed exports (Cindervale Reports)

If the nightly export fails, do not re-run the full batch immediately. First confirm the upstream warehouse is reachable, then requeue only the failed partitions via the admin console. Retries respect backoff limits, so a second manual trigger within the window is ignored. The retry behavior is governed by the settings below.

service settings:
WENATH_LOG_LEVEL=debug
WENATH_METRICS_HOST=metrics.wenath.norvalabs.internal
WENATH_POOL_SIZE=16

# Pixelpane Environments

Hey on-call! Quick map of where Pixelpane's snapshot tests for UI components actually run. Staging renders against the Quillbury fixture set nightly; prod-mirror only runs on release candidates. If snapshots flake, it's almost always a font cache mismatch between the two — clear it before blaming the components. The baseline store lives in the Drossel bucket, rotated weekly. When you need to compare environments, the staging service config is listed below.

config for kafof-bawef:
holath:
  log_level: debug
  metrics_host: metrics.holath.qorvelsys.internal
  pin: 2191
  pool_size: 32

## Local Setup

`tailgrim` is our internal CLI for tailing service logs. Build with `make tailgrim`, then run `tailgrim init` to generate a local config. It streams from the Varnock broker by default; override with `--source`. Cursor positions are persisted per stream so restarts resume cleanly. Checkpoint state lives in the ops database, reachable via the connection string below.

replica DSN, kajep-yahag: mssql://praok_svc:iF@db-8d68.plorvaio.local:5432/eliion